Smoking and physical inactivity increase cardiovascular disease risks among Singaporeans, shown in a research study by CADENCE
A research study, Al4HealthyCities-Singapore (Al4HealthyCities-SG), led by our programme, the Cardiovascular Disease National Collaborative Enterprise (CADENCE) in partnership with the Novartis Foundation’s Al4HealthyCities initiative, found that smoking and physical inactivity are major contributors to cardiovascular disease risks among Singaporeans.
These findings shed light on a pressing health challenge and provide crucial insights to inform targeted interventions.
